Arsenal shopping spree

Arsenal are pushing ahead with a move for Valencia's young centre-back Cristhian Mosquera in a bid to bolster their defence this summer.

Mosquera is said to have agreed to join Arsenal.

According to The Athletic , the 20-year-old Spaniard is a top transfer target for manager Mikel Arteta. The deal is progressing quite positively. Transfer expert Fabrizio Romano added that Mosquera has "given the green light" for Arsenal to complete the deal.

The Gunners have begun negotiating a price with Valencia, with Mosquera having only 12 months left on his contract. The London club see him as an ideal backup for key duo William Saliba and Gabriel, after losing out on Dean Huijsen to Real Madrid.

Mosquera is the versatile defender Arteta is looking for, able to play on the right and at full-back when required. Meanwhile, Jakub Kiwior - who has been a reserve for over two seasons - is said to be on his way out of the Emirates. Juventus and Inter Milan are both keeping tabs on the Polish centre-back.

Mosquera has made 90 appearances for Valencia's first team, including 41 last season. He is also a regular at Spain's youth levels, having made 10 appearances for the under-21s, including against England at this summer's European Championship.

Arsenal have been on a shopping spree after finishing second in the Premier League for three straight seasons. They have completed the signings of Kepa Arrizabalaga and Martin Zubimendi, which will be announced in the coming days. They have also agreed a deal to sign Brentford midfielder Christian Norgaard for £9.3m.

Not stopping there, Arsenal also focused on recruiting a quality striker. They were interested in Viktor Gyokeres from Sporting Lisbon, but the Portuguese club demanded no less than 85 million pounds to let him go. In addition, RB Leipzig's Benjamin Sesko was also targeted by Arsenal.
